Exclusive Household Staff is seeking an experienced temporary Maternity Nanny to care for a 5-month-old baby boy in Greater London. The role involves following established feeding and sleeping routines, preparing bottles, and supporting the baby's development with age-appropriate activities.
The ideal candidate will have previous experience as a maternity nanny or nurse, demonstrating a calm and professional manner. This position offers a competitive rate of £25 gross per hour.
